Resumen: Several experimental measurements of B meson decays, in tension with Standard Model predictions, exhibit large sources of Lepton Flavour Universality violation. We perform an analysis of the effects of the global fits to the Wilson coefficients assuming a model independent effective Hamiltonian approach, by including a proposal of different scenarios to include the New Physics contributions. Both the current fits at the LHC and the ILC projections are considered. We found that for a simultaneous analysis of predictions for the RD(∗) and RK(∗) observables, the scenarios with three non-universal Wilson coefficients are favoured.
